Abstract
1,267,896. Mixing apparatus. SHELL INTERNATIONALE RESEARCH MAATSCHAPPIJ N.V. 12 Oct., 1970 [14 Oct., 1969], No. 48339/70. Heading B1C. [Also in Division Cl] A process for the removal of solid particles from an aqueous suspension thereof comprising a housing 16 containing a mixing vessel 14 and a separating vessel 15. Stirring devices 17 and 18, both mounted on the shaft 19, are provided in the vessels 14 and 15. An aqueous suspension of solid particles is supplied via the inlet 22, and auxiliary liquid is supplied via inlet 23. The resulting mixture passes to the separating vessel via the aperture 21 and is . mixed with further auxiliary liquid, fed into this vessel via. inlet 24. Water free of agglomerates is discharged through outlet 25, and agglomerates in auxiliary liquid is discharged at the outlet 26.
